Merge #10699: Make all script validation flags backward compatible
01013f5Simplify tx validation tests (Pieter Wuille)2dd6f80Add a test that all flags are softforks (Pieter Wuille)2851b77Make all script verification flags softforks (Pieter Wuille) Pull request description: This change makes `SCRIPT_VERIFY_UPGRADABLE_NOPS` not apply to `OP_CHECKLOCKTIMEVERIFY` and `OP_CHECKSEQUENCEVERIFY`. This is a no-op as `UPGRADABLE_NOPS` is only set for mempool transactions, and those always have `SCRIPT_VERIFY_CHECKLOCKTIMEVERIFY` and `SCRIPT_VERIFY_CHECKSEQUENCEVERIFY` set as well. The advantage is that setting more flags now always results in a reduction in acceptable scripts (=softfork). This results in a nice and testable property for validation, for which a new test is added. This also means that the introduction of a new definition for a NOP or witness version will likely need the following procedure (example OP_NOP8 here) * Remove OP_NOP8 from being affected by `SCRIPT_VERIFY_DISCOURAGE_UPGRADABLE_NOPS`. * Add a `SCRIPT_VERIFY_DISCOURAGE_NOP8`, which only applies to `OP_NOP8`. * Add a `SCRIPT_VERIFY_NOP8` which implements the new consensus logic. * Before activation, add `SCRIPT_VERIFY_DISCOURAGE_NOP8` to the mempool flags. * After activation, add `SCRIPT_VERIFY_NOP8` to both the mempool and consensus flags.
